Typical seismic data logger NDAS-8436N

The NDAS-8436N typical seismic data logger is designed to acquire and transfer high quality data in seismic networks and store data on a local drive.

The model provides a 32-bit synchronized data registration via 6 channels and is well suited for connecting analog instruments by various manufacturers.

Along with analog instruments, there is an option to connect digital seismometers and digital accelerometers made by R-sensors. The data are stored in a file on a local memory card as well as on external USB drives in the miniSEED, binary and text formats.

The SeedLink v4 protocol with a 100 msec package is used for telemetry. 

When operating as part of early warning systems, the recording mode with a minimum delay is used.

The system is clocked with a high precision quartz that is being corrected with the use of external sources of GPS/GLONASS accurate time signals as well as via Ethernet over NTP and PTP protocols.

The data logger has 4 auxilliary channels as well as alarm relays to control external devices.

The data logger has a bilingual interface of Russian and English. It is possible to set the interface language at the customer's request.

Delivery set 1.5 m USB type A/B standard cable, 3 m active GPS antenna, Wi-Fi SMA antenna (option), microSD 32 GB, User manual
Dynamic range 131.8 dB at 100 sps
Supply voltage 12 - 48 V (7.5 - 60 V permissible)
Power consumption 1.5 W excluding sensors, Wi-Fi, 3G, Ethernet; 2.2 W typical average
Number of channels 6
Temperature range -20...+85°C - standard SD-card
ADC sampling rate 100, 125, 200, 250, 400, 500, 800, 1000, 2000, 4000 Hz
Gain coefficients 1, 2, 4, 8, 16, 32, 64
ADC resolution 32 bit
Reference generator stability 0.5 ppm
Data recording mode continuous, schedule
Data recording format binary, ASCII, miniSEED v3
Data storage microSD 32 GB, option of up to 512 GB
Data transfer SeedLink v4 over Ethernet
Inbuilt sensors for device health monitoring temperature, humidity
Case connectors 7-pin type for RS-485 power and interface; 10-pin type for inputs of main ADC for calibration and sensors power (2 pcs); inputs of auxilliary ADC and outputs of signal relay (1 pc); micro USB-B for data reading and configuration; RJ-45 type for Ethernet; USB-A for connecting external drives and CME-ND digital sensors; SMA-F type for GPS / Wi-Fi / 3G / 4G / LTE antennas
GNSS timing accuracy < 10 µs
GNSS receiver GPS / GLONASS
Auxiliary ADC 12 bit, 4 single-ended or 2 differential channels, 0.1, 1.0, 4.0 sps
Additional network options Up to 24 ADC channels, RS-485 wired interface to connect external sensors
Case material Aluminum alloy, IP-66 waterproof
Dimensions 275 х 190 х 100 mm including connectors
Weight 2.4 kg
